1. Hydration Hero

Seriously, drink up. Dehydration makes your skin look dull and thin, which means those blood vessels under your eyes become way more obvious. Think of it as plumping up your skin from the inside out.

Pro tip: Keep a cute water bottle nearby and refill it constantly. Your skin will thank you, and so will your energy levels.

Why it works: A well-hydrated body means plumper, healthier-looking skin, reducing the appearance of those shadowy areas.

2. Sleep Sanctuary

This one feels obvious, right? But seriously, skimping on sleep is like an open invitation for dark circles to set up camp. Aim for 7-9 hours of quality shut-eye every night.

Pro tip: Elevate your head slightly with an extra pillow to prevent fluid pooling under your eyes overnight.

Why it works: Adequate rest allows your body to repair itself, reduces fluid retention, and prevents blood vessels from dilating and showing through thin skin.

3. Cool Compresses

Grab anything cold and apply it. Think chilled spoons, cucumber slices, or a damp washcloth. The cold constricts blood vessels, instantly reducing puffiness and darkness.

Pro tip: Keep a couple of gel eye masks in the fridge for those emergency ‘I woke up like this’ moments.

Why it works: Cold therapy reduces swelling and shrinks dilated blood vessels, providing quick, temporary relief from puffiness and dark tones.

4. Caffeine Kick

Your morning latte isn’t just for waking you up. Products with caffeine can temporarily constrict blood vessels under your eyes, making them less noticeable. Think coffee grounds or green tea bags.

Pro tip: Steep two green tea bags, let them cool completely in the fridge, then place them over your eyes for 10-15 minutes. It’s a spa moment, but make it quick.

Why it works: Caffeine is a vasoconstrictor, meaning it narrows blood vessels, reducing the appearance of darkness caused by visible blood flow.

5. Retinol Rollers

For the long game, retinol is your BFF. It encourages cell turnover and boosts collagen production, thickening the delicate skin under your eyes. This makes underlying blood vessels less visible.

Pro tip: Start with a low concentration retinol eye cream a few times a week, and always, always follow up with SPF during the day. Retinol makes your skin more sun-sensitive.

Why it works: Retinol strengthens and thickens the skin, making it more resilient and less transparent, thus camouflaging underlying discoloration.

6. Vitamin C Brightness

This antioxidant powerhouse isn’t just for your immune system. Topical Vitamin C brightens skin, reduces hyperpigmentation, and boosts collagen, giving you a more even-toned, luminous look.

Pro tip: Look for an eye serum that combines Vitamin C with Ferulic Acid for an extra antioxidant punch. Apply it in the morning to protect against environmental damage.

Why it works: Vitamin C inhibits melanin production and brightens the skin, directly targeting pigmentation that contributes to dark circles.

7. Hyaluronic Acid Hydration

If your dark circles are more about shadows from dehydration or thin skin, hyaluronic acid is your hero. It draws moisture into the skin, plumping it up and smoothing out fine lines.

Pro tip: Apply your hyaluronic acid serum to slightly damp skin, then seal it in with a good eye cream to maximize its hydrating benefits.

Why it works: Hyaluronic acid intensely hydrates and plumps the skin, reducing shadows caused by volume loss and making the skin appear thicker and smoother.

8. Eye Cream Ritual

Consistency is key here. A good eye cream, applied morning and night, can make a huge difference. Look for ingredients like peptides, ceramides, and niacinamide.

Pro tip: Apply your eye cream with your ring finger using a gentle tapping motion. Don’t drag or pull the delicate skin around your eyes.

Why it works: Regular use of targeted eye creams provides continuous nourishment and support, addressing various causes of dark circles over time.

9. Gentle Makeup Removal

Stop scrubbing like you’re trying to remove permanent marker. Aggressively rubbing your eyes can cause irritation, inflammation, and even break tiny capillaries, making dark circles worse.

Pro tip: Use a gentle, oil-based makeup remover or micellar water. Hold a soaked cotton pad over your eyes for a few seconds to dissolve makeup before gently wiping away.

Why it works: Gentle removal prevents trauma to the delicate skin, avoiding irritation and damage that can exacerbate discoloration and puffiness.

10. Sun Protection

UV exposure can worsen hyperpigmentation and break down collagen, making those dark circles even more pronounced. SPF isn’t just for your face; your eyes need protection too.

Pro tip: Wear sunglasses that offer UVA/UVB protection and generously apply a mineral-based SPF around your eyes daily, even on cloudy days.

Why it works: Sun protection prevents melanin production and collagen degradation, which are major contributors to increased pigmentation and thin skin around the eyes.

11. Dietary Delights

Sometimes, dark circles are a sign of internal imbalances. Ensure your diet is rich in iron, Vitamin K, and B12. Think leafy greens, lean meats, and eggs.

Pro tip: If you suspect a deficiency, chat with your doctor. They can recommend supplements if needed, but always prioritize whole foods.

Why it works: Proper nutrition supports healthy blood circulation and prevents deficiencies that can manifest as pallor and darker under-eye areas.

12. Allergy Alert

Chronic allergies can lead to “allergic shiners” โ€“ those dark, puffy circles from constant rubbing and inflammation. If you’re always itchy and sniffly, this might be your culprit.

Pro tip: Talk to an allergist about identifying your triggers and finding the right antihistamines or treatments to keep those sneezes (and eye rubs) at bay.

Why it works: Managing allergies reduces inflammation and prevents constant rubbing, which directly contributes to discoloration and puffiness.

13. Lymphatic Massage

Gentle massage can help drain excess fluid and toxins from the under-eye area, reducing puffiness and making darkness less prominent. Think of it as a little detox session for your face.

Pro tip: Use a jade roller or your ring finger. Start from the inner corner of your eye and gently roll or tap outwards towards your temples. Repeat a few times.

Why it works: Manual lymphatic drainage encourages fluid movement, reducing stagnation and puffiness that can create shadows and emphasize discoloration.

14. Concealer Confidence

When all else fails (or you just need an immediate fix), a good concealer is your secret weapon. Choose one that’s a shade lighter than your skin tone and has a peachy or orange undertone to counteract blue/purple hues.

Pro tip: Apply concealer in a triangle shape under your eye, rather than just a crescent. Blend gently with a damp beauty sponge for a seamless finish.

Why it works: Concealer provides instant cosmetic coverage, effectively neutralizing discoloration and brightening the under-eye area for a refreshed look.
